What is Antenatal Checkup?
For pregnant women, a regular schedule of an Antenatal Checkup is essential to know the updates on the fetus. The screening is done by ultrasound, which does not harm or carry any side effects for both mother and the child.

How It Works
Ultrasound scan works by using sound waves to produce images from the resonance on the inside of the body. For Antenatal Checkup, the scan creates a picture of your baby in your womb. You will be able to see the well-being as well as hear the heartbeat as early as 5 to 6 weeks after gestation.

FAQ
Q1: When can I know the gender of the baby with an ultrasound?
A1: You will be able to know the gender after about 12 weeks of pregnancy.
Q2: Can too many ultrasounds harm the baby?
A2: According to both FDA and ACOG, there is no evidence that ultrasounds can harm the fetus.
Q3: How accurate is the due date by ultrasound?
A3: The most accurate time may be determined between 8 and 11 weeks gestation.
